Sabatini Drops Out of House Race After Trump Endorses Opponent

Former Florida Republican legislator Anthony Sabatini on Thursday dropped out of the GOP primary for his congressional race, hours after Donald Trump endorsed his opponent, incumbent U.S. Rep. Daniel Webster.

“Today, Donald Trump endorsed the incumbent in my race,” Sabatini wrote on X, the platform formerly known as Twitter. “I don’t always agree with Donald Trump’s endorsements, but I understand the political reality of what they are. Tonight, I am withdrawing from District 11, and I will be running for the Lake County Commission. We need stronger Republicans in local office fighting for the America 1st agenda. District 11 will have to wait for another day.”

Sabatini has been a staunch Trump supporter — in 2021 he sponsored an amendment to name one of the state’s highways after Trump — and has been attacking Webster for months as a RINO — Republican in name only.
